Move Photos between pages in book

Making my first photobook in iphotos.
Created book from an album and has autofilled.
I understand that I can move photos within a page but how can I exchange a photo from one page for a photo in another page?
Thanks for any help.
Arthur

You cannot directly switch photos between pages.
Just drag the photo you want to add to a page from the "Photos" tab (All Photos) onto the photo that you want to remove. Do the same for the photo on the second page.

  • Is there a way to move photos between events in Search mode?

    I have just switched over to iPhoto on my new Mac (from PS Elements 5 on my old PC) and I am trying to get everything organized again. All the files have been put in Events, but not always theEvenst I want them in. What I keep wanting to do is run a search on file names (which works beautifully!) and then move some of the resulting items from one event into another. This doesn't seem to be possible, though. Am I missing something?
    Thanks in advance for any and all advice!

    Julanne
    Welcome to the Apple Discussions.
    I completely agree with Larry's comments about Albums being a far superior method of organisation. However, to move files from a search you can use Flagging:
    Simply Flag the files you want to move then, from the Events menu, choose either: 'Create Events from Flagged Photos' or "Add Flagged Photos to Selected Events' as you require.
    Here's a tip - as these things are easy to make a mistake on: -z will undo the last thing you did.

  • Move photos between communities?

    I just downloaded Elements 10, and have imported into 2 communities from 2 iPhoto libraries. Is there a way to move some photos out of one community and put them in another?

    What is a community? Do you mean a catalog?  If so, probably the fastest way is just to use File>Get Photos>From files and folders and go to where the organizer put the new copies it made when you used the import command. The catalog is just a database. One photo can be in a dozen different catalogs if you want, without duplicating the image.
    Then go back to the catalog where you want to remove the photos, select all the ones you don't want in that catalog and right click one and choose Delete from Catalog (just don't also choose Delete from hard drive).
    But most people opt to have  one catalog for all their photos and use albums in PSE for what iphoto uses events for.
